You know when you had good Vietnamese food when you leave and think "this is not another pho joint". Some quickly performed Yelp researched resulted in us picking this place for a quick lunch, and it turned out to be a great choice.
We got to try the BBQ SHRIMP & CHICKEN combo ($11) that was nicely flavored and well presented on a large plate. The BEEF MIGNON SOUP ($9) was rich and took on the flavor from the tender meat that had some chunks of fat to it - flavorful. My stomach only take so much - so next time the rest of the colorful menu will be explored.
Ben Tre is right on Grand in South San Francisco and quite the popular spot - usually there's a line but it moves quickly.
